comparison multimodal_learner.py @ 6:871957823d0c draft default tip

planemo upload for repository https://github.com/goeckslab/gleam.git commit 6e49ad44dd8572382ee203926690a30d7e888203
author goeckslab
date Mon, 26 Jan 2026 18:44:07 +0000
parents 975512caae22
children
comparison
equal deleted inserted replaced
5:975512caae22 6:871957823d0c
61 parser.add_argument("--cross_validation", type=str, default="false") 61 parser.add_argument("--cross_validation", type=str, default="false")
62 parser.add_argument("--num_folds", type=int, default=5) 62 parser.add_argument("--num_folds", type=int, default=5)
63 parser.add_argument("--epochs", type=int, default=None) 63 parser.add_argument("--epochs", type=int, default=None)
64 parser.add_argument("--learning_rate", type=float, default=None) 64 parser.add_argument("--learning_rate", type=float, default=None)
65 parser.add_argument("--batch_size", type=int, default=None) 65 parser.add_argument("--batch_size", type=int, default=None)
66 parser.add_argument("--num_workers", type=int, default=None,
67 help="DataLoader worker count (0 disables multiprocessing).")
68 parser.add_argument("--num_workers_eval", type=int, default=None,
69 help="DataLoader workers for evaluation; defaults to --num_workers.")
66 parser.add_argument("--backbone_image", type=str, default="swin_base_patch4_window7_224") 70 parser.add_argument("--backbone_image", type=str, default="swin_base_patch4_window7_224")
67 parser.add_argument("--backbone_text", type=str, default="microsoft/deberta-v3-base") 71 parser.add_argument("--backbone_text", type=str, default="microsoft/deberta-v3-base")
68 parser.add_argument("--validation_size", type=float, default=0.2) 72 parser.add_argument("--validation_size", type=float, default=0.2)
69 parser.add_argument("--split_probabilities", type=float, nargs=3, 73 parser.add_argument("--split_probabilities", type=float, nargs=3,
70 default=[0.7, 0.1, 0.2], metavar=("train", "val", "test")) 74 default=[0.7, 0.1, 0.2], metavar=("train", "val", "test"))
367 time_limit=args.time_limit, 371 time_limit=args.time_limit,
368 random_seed=args.random_seed, 372 random_seed=args.random_seed,
369 epochs=args.epochs, 373 epochs=args.epochs,
370 learning_rate=args.learning_rate, 374 learning_rate=args.learning_rate,
371 batch_size=args.batch_size, 375 batch_size=args.batch_size,
376 num_workers=args.num_workers,
377 num_workers_evaluation=args.num_workers_eval,
372 backbone_image=args.backbone_image, 378 backbone_image=args.backbone_image,
373 backbone_text=args.backbone_text, 379 backbone_text=args.backbone_text,
374 preset=args.preset, 380 preset=args.preset,
375 eval_metric=args.eval_metric, 381 eval_metric=args.eval_metric,
376 hyperparameters=args.hyperparameters, 382 hyperparameters=args.hyperparameters,